Course Content

• Agri-Research Value Chain Analysis: Principles and Practices
• Data Analytics for Agricultural Research & Value Chain Optimization
• Market Research and Demand Forecasting in Agriculture
• Value Chain Mapping and Stakeholder Analysis (including supply chain management)
• Agricultural Policy and its Impact on Value Chains
• Financial Analysis and Investment Appraisal in Agri-businesses
• Innovation and Technology Adoption in Agricultural Value Chains
• Sustainable Agricultural Value Chain Development (with focus on environmental sustainability)
• Case Studies in Agri-Research Value Chain Analysis (includes best practices and challenges)

Career path

Career Role Description
Agri-Research Analyst (UK) Analyze data, identify trends, and develop strategies for improving agricultural research and value chain efficiency in the UK’s thriving food and agriculture sector. Requires strong analytical and data visualization skills.
Agricultural Value Chain Consultant Consult with agricultural businesses to optimize their value chain, incorporating sustainability and supply chain management best practices for improved agricultural outputs in the UK. Requires excellent communication and problem-solving skills.
Precision Agriculture Specialist Implement and manage precision agriculture technologies, improving resource efficiency in farming systems across the UK. Requires expertise in data analysis and agricultural technology.
Agri-Business Development Manager (UK) Develop and implement strategies to improve the commercial success of agricultural businesses across the UK. Requires strong business acumen and marketing expertise within the Agri-Food sector.
